Toto fórum používá cookies
Toto fóru používá cookies k ukládání údajů o přihlašení pokud jste registrovaný uživatel a o poslední návštěvě pokud nejste. Cookies jsou malé textové dokumenty ukládané na vašem pocítači; cookies nastavené tímto fórem mohou být použity pouze na této webové stránce a nepředstavují žádné bezpečnostní riziko. Cookies na tomto fóru také sledují konkrétní témata, která jste si přečetli a kdy jste je naposledy přečetli. Potvrďte, zda přijmete nebo odmítnete nastavené soubory cookie.

Soubor cookie bude uložen ve vašem prohlížeči bez ohledu na volbu, aby vám tato otázka nebyla znovu položena. Nastavení cookie budete moci kdykoli změnit pomocí odkazu v zápatí.

Hodnocení tématu:
  • 0 Hlas(ů) - 0 Průměr
  • 1
  • 2
  • 3
  • 4
  • 5
GPU passthrough na notebooku
#41
Este mi napadlo, ze ten patch na OVMF, ktory som skusal, sa nemusel aplikovat spravne. Takze to skusim patchnut manualne. Zatial budem skusat Linux vo VM (Arch Linux + binarne ovladace pre NVIDIU) namiesto Windowsu. Ked bude Linux vo VM fungovat s binarnymi ovladacmi, tak potom skusim aj Windows.
Odpovědět
#42
Zatial ziaden pokrok. Nainstaloval som Arch Linux do VM, ktorej som priradil NVIDIA GPU (primarna je QXL), pouzil som patchnute OVMF (zatial pomocou toho PKGBUILDu, nie manualne), VBIOS som ziskal z nouveau debug interface (/sys/kernel/debug/dri/1/vbios.rom), no ani nouveau, ani binarne NVIDIA ovladace nefungovali. V dmesg bola chyba, ze nie je mozne ziskat vbios. Nouveau vsak funguje, ked je VBIOS podstrceny VM cez
Kód:
-device vfio-pci ... romfile=vbios.rom
PS: pozeral som zdrojove subory, z ktorych bolo skompilovane to patchnute OVMF a vyzeralo to OK; VBIOS by tiez mal byt OK, kedze nouveau s nim funguje, vystup z rom-parser tiez vyzera OK
Odpovědět
#43
To je ten postup, kdy obsah BIOSu je přímo součástí zdrojáku?
Odpovědět
#44
Ano, patchnute OVMF, aby v ACPI tabulke poskytlo VBIOS.

https://github.com/jscinoz/optimus-vfio-docs/issues/2
Odpovědět
#45
Vyzera to tak, ze som sa zbavil code 43 error
Odpovědět
#46
[Obrázek: MNH0CaG.jpg]
https://i.imgur.com/MNH0CaG.jpg

Problemom bola zla adresa PCI bridge vo VM, povodne som pouzil adresu 00:1c.0 (tak ako je to na zeleze), no to nefungovalo, tak som podla tohto navodu skusil pouzit adresu 00:01.0 a to fungovalo. Code 43 error zmizol, no kedze NVIDIA GPU nema ziaden graficky vystup musel som VM nechat priradenu aj QXL GPU. Niektore programy, ako napriklad FurMark vyuzivaju NVIDIA GPU (screenshot z minuleho postu), no niektore nie.
Odpovědět
#47
Thumbs Up 
Každopádně gratulace. 
Odpovědět
#48
(28-07-2018, 06:36 PM)xyz Napsal(a): https://i.imgur.com/MNH0CaG.jpg

Problemom bola zla adresa PCI bridge vo VM, povodne som pouzil adresu 00:1c.0 (tak ako je to na zeleze), no to nefungovalo, tak som podla tohto navodu skusil pouzit adresu 00:01.0 a to fungovalo. Code 43 error zmizol, no kedze NVIDIA GPU nema ziaden graficky vystup musel som VM nechat priradenu aj QXL GPU. Niektore programy, ako napriklad FurMark vyuzivaju NVIDIA GPU (screenshot z minuleho postu), no niektore nie.

Takže neplatí to co se píše v tom návodu, že IOH3420 musí mít stejnou addr jako fyzický PCI bridge na železe?
Odpovědět
#49
Aspon u mna nie, ked som pouzil adresu 00:1c.0 pre PCI bridge, tak vysledok bol code 43 error, ale ked som pouzil adresu 00:01.0, tak code 43 error zmizol. Samozrejme treba pouzit patchnute OVMF, ktore cez ACPI poskytne VBIOS pre NVIDIA GPU. Rychly test VM s Linuxom (Fedora 28 Live) ukazal, ze aj nouveau si teraz VBIOS nacita z ACPI, ked je adresa toho PCI bridge 00:01.0. Binarne NVIDIA ovladace som neskusal, mozno niekedy nabuduce. Najjednoduhsi sposob ako ziskat VBIOS (aspon v mojom pripade, muxless zapojenie, NVIDIA bez grafickeho vystupu) je pouzit nouveau debug interface /sys/kernel/debug/dri/0/vbios.rom. Uz len najst lepsi sposob ako RDP, lebo nie vsetky aplikacie vedia vyuzit NVIDIA GPU vo VM. Mozno Looking Glass bude fungovat...
Odpovědět


[-]
Rychlá odpověď
Zpráva
Text Vaší zprávy:

Obrázková verifikace
Do textového pole dole zadejte text, který vidíte na obrázku vlevo. Toto opatření má znemožnit psaní příspěvků spam robotům.
Obrázková verifikace
(necitlivé na velikost písma)

Přejít na fórum:


Uživatel(é) prohlížející toto téma: 2 host(ů)